Impact of Childhood Sexual Abuse on Reproductive Choices

Survivors of childhood sexual abuse often face uniquely complex circumstances when making decisions about pregnancy and abortion. The trauma of abuse can profoundly influence their relationship with their bodies, healthcare providers, and reproductive choices.

Many survivors report feeling a loss of bodily autonomy twice - first through the abuse, and then through an unwanted pregnancy resulting from that abuse. This compounds the psychological impact and can make the decision-making process particularly challenging.

Common Experiences and Emotions

Survivors frequently describe experiencing:

  • Intense feelings of fear and powerlessness
  • Difficulty trusting healthcare providers
  • Complex emotions about bodily autonomy
  • Challenges accessing appropriate support services
  • Confusion about their rights and options

Psychological Impact and Recovery Process

The psychological effects of experiencing both sexual abuse and abortion can be profound and long-lasting. Many survivors face complex trauma that requires specialized support and understanding from mental health professionals.

Processing Trauma and Grief

Recovery often involves working through multiple layers of emotional experiences:

  • Coming to terms with the abuse history
  • Processing decisions about pregnancy and abortion
  • Addressing feelings of shame or stigma
  • Rebuilding trust in healthcare systems
  • Developing healthy coping mechanisms

Finding Support and Pursuing Justice

Support systems play a crucial role in helping survivors heal and potentially seek justice. Many find strength in connecting with other survivors through support groups, advocacy organizations, and trauma-informed counseling services.

Resources for Healing

Survivors can access various forms of support:

  • Trauma-informed reproductive healthcare providers
  • Specialized mental health counseling
  • Legal advocacy services
  • Survivor support groups
  • Crisis hotlines and online resources

Breaking Stigma Through Shared Experiences

Sharing personal stories about abortion and sexual abuse survival can help reduce isolation and challenge societal stigma. When survivors feel safe to share their experiences, it creates space for broader understanding and improved support systems.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are common experiences shared in personal abortion stories related to childhood sexual abuse?

Common experiences include feelings of powerlessness, complex decision-making processes, challenges with healthcare access, and the need for specialized support services. Many survivors report struggling with trust issues and requiring trauma-informed care throughout their journey.

How can repeated childhood sexual abuse affect a young person's decisions about abortion?

Repeated childhood sexual abuse can significantly impact decision-making by creating complex trauma responses, affecting trust in healthcare providers, and influencing feelings about bodily autonomy. The experience often requires additional emotional support and specialized counseling during the decision-making process.

What psychological impacts do survivors of familial sexual abuse often face after abortion?

Survivors may experience complex post-traumatic stress, depression, anxiety, and challenges with trust and relationships. Many report needing to process multiple layers of trauma while working through feelings about both the abuse and the abortion experience.
